Breast-milk Enema Administration to Stimulate Passage of Meconium
NCT07661992 · Status: NOT_YET_RECRUITING · Phase: PHASE1 · Type: INTERVENTIONAL · Enrollment: 20
Last updated 2026-07-28
Summary
Lack of passage of meconium in preterm infants delays feeding advancement and may represent a risk factor for necrotizing enterocolitis (NEC) and spontaneous intestinal perforation (SIP). Usual management of meconium impaction has included glycerin suppositories and normal saline enemas. Various methods are used in routine neonatal care to promote meconium evacuation; however, there is no consensus on the agents used and the frequency of applications

breast milk
A small-volume rectal enema consisting of 5 mL/kg of fresh mother's own breast milk will be administered as a single dose, with the option for one repeat dose at 24 hours if clinically indicated.
